# Webhook delivery retries for the Fernwick dispatch service follow
# exponential backoff with jitter. A delivery is abandoned after the
# final attempt and queued to the dead-letter store, where the Orlo
# console surfaces it for manual replay. Changing these values requires
# a note in the release checklist, since partner SLAs reference them
# directly. The constants below govern the schedule.

tuning constants:
BUDGETS = {
    "druath": 240,
    "lamwyn": 180,
    "silael": 275,
}

- [ ] **Step 7: Breaker override escrow.** After sealing the signing keys for the Tallgrove upstream API circuit breaker, confirm the support team can force the breaker open during a full outage. The override bundle lives in the sealed escrow drawer and is useless without its unlock phrase. Two ceremony witnesses must initial this step before proceeding. The escrow bundle is decrypted with the recovery passphrase that follows.

vault phrase of kahip-kahop = holath-quenmir

Break-Glass Access — Quillrate Fees Engine. Use this procedure only when the shipping-fee rules engine is returning errors in production and no on-call engineer responds within fifteen minutes. Break-glass grants temporary write access to the live rule set; every change is audited and auto-reverted after two hours. Record the incident number first, then authenticate to the emergency console with the recovery passphrase shown below.

recovery phrase for kajep-tajep: ulaox-ralax-gorwyn

# Orwick Partners — Term Sheet (Managers Only)

Orwick Partners has issued a revised term sheet for the Lanehurst distribution deal. Key points: three-year exclusivity, volume rebates tiered at 8/12/15 percent, and a joint marketing fund. Doral Vance is lead negotiator. Branch managers: do not discuss terms with staff or clients. Context on where this fits our plans appears below.

management briefing: Jorixax Holdings is in early talks to buy Casixax Holdings for about $420.3 million. The Fenmir launch date is October 27, and nothing goes to the press before then. Legal wants the Keloxek Foods term sheet redrafted before April 16.